About This Position

Description:

Summary:

This position will be responsible for designing, implementing, and managing data architecture, and database systems to support our business objectives and ensure data integrity, security, and availability. This position is responsible for modeling, designing and implementing a modern data stack that enables the creation of scalable applications, and gaining knowledge and insight from the data. The position is responsible for all data sources concerning business operations and outlines a design to integrate, centralize and maintain data.

Functions:

  • Lead a cross-functional data engineering team through the full project lifecycle: requirements gathering, design, development, testing, deployment, and hand-off to operations.
  • Mentor engineers on best practices in data modeling, ETL, CI/CD, and cloud governance. Develop and maintain a cloud strategy for the enterprise.
  • Design and implement scalable, secure, and cost-effective cloud solutions.
  • Implement data governance policies and procedures to ensure data security and compliance with industry standards.
  • Create and maintain conceptual, logical, and physical data models along with corresponding metadata using best practices to ensure high data quality and data access
  • Define and evolve Goodville’s Azure data platform blueprint, including SQL Database, Service Bus, Function Apps, Key Vault, and Data Factory pipelines.
  • Architect and administer Microsoft Fabric Lake houses: manage Delta/Parquet storage, notebook orchestration, and pipeline workflows.
  • Design, implement, and optimize scalable ETL/ELT pipelines using Azure Data Factory and Fabric pipelines.
  • Integrate diverse source systems (on-prem IBMi, third-party APIs, relational databases) into unified lake house/silver/gold layers.
  • Design and maintain data models, data flow diagrams, and data integration processes.
  • Play a key role in the process of data transformation required for effective reporting, analytics, and visualization.
  • Work closely with cross functional teams and leadership to improve the quality and value of core data assets, respond to regulatory protection requirements.
  • Build and maintain monitoring/alerting for Azure resources and Fabric workloads to ensure reliability, performance, and cost efficiency.
  • Implement automated provisioning and CI/CD for data infrastructure (ARM/Bicep, GitHub Actions).
  • Partner with stakeholders to translate business requirements into a cohesive data platform strategy, balancing immediate deliverables with long-term scalability.
  • Lay the groundwork for AI/ML feature pipelines and model-ops integration within Fabric and Azure ML.
